Skip to content
Snippets Groups Projects
Commit 629d264d authored by FCGudder's avatar FCGudder
Browse files

Allow strings to be enclosed in quotes

parent a2358cf5
No related branches found
No related tags found
4 merge requests!843Delete Please.,!833Pregmod master,!758Pregmod master,!503Allow strings to be enclosed in quotes
...@@ -247,9 +247,14 @@ window.evalExpr = function(expr, env) { ...@@ -247,9 +247,14 @@ window.evalExpr = function(expr, env) {
return true; return true;
case "false": case "false":
return false; return false;
case "(number)": case "(string)": case "(number)":
return expr.value; return expr.value;
case "(string)":
if(expr.value.startsWith('"') && expr.value.endsWith('"')) {
return JSON.parse(expr.value);
} else {
return expr.value;
}
case "(name)": case "(name)":
return env[expr.name]; return env[expr.name];
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ment